Congratulations to Senior Doubles team Marissa Mangala and Denna Zayed as they went 6-0 and won the STATE CHAMPIONSHIP!!!! Seeded 3rd entering the tournament, Mariss and Denna defeated the top seeded team in the semis and their arch-nemesis TF South in the state finals to earn the State Championship. As a doubles team, this is Marissa and Denna’s second state medal, as they finished 4th last year as juniors. Also competing this past weekend were seniors Jessica Bachleda and Riyan Yanes. Entering the tournament unseeded,Jessica and Riyan finished 7-1 earning 5th place. After winning their first 2 matches and losing their third, the duo battled hard and won 5 straight matches to finish in 5th. Along the way, the team defeated two teams they had previously suffered defeat to. Jessica and Riyan were the only state contestants in the tournament in singles or doubles that earned a medal while being unseeded. The badminton team finished in 4th place, only ½ point out of 2nd.
